CAS 51263-40-2
:methyl 2-bromo-3-methylbut-2-enoate
Description:
Methyl 2-bromo-3-methylbut-2-enoate is an organic compound characterized by its structure, which includes a bromine atom and an ester functional group. It features a double bond in the butenoate moiety, contributing to its reactivity and potential applications in organic synthesis. The presence of the bromine atom makes it a suitable candidate for nucleophilic substitution reactions, while the methyl ester group enhances its solubility in organic solvents. This compound is typically a colorless to pale yellow liquid with a distinctive odor. It is important to handle it with care due to its potential toxicity and reactivity. Methyl 2-bromo-3-methylbut-2-enoate can be utilized in various chemical reactions, including cross-coupling and as an intermediate in the synthesis of more complex molecules. Its unique structure and functional groups make it a valuable compound in the field of organic chemistry, particularly in the development of pharmaceuticals and agrochemicals.
Formula:C6H9BrO2
InChI:InChI=1/C6H9BrO2/c1-4(2)5(7)6(8)9-3/h1-3H3
SMILES:CC(=C(C(=O)OC)Br)C
Synonyms:- 2-Butenoic acid, 2-bromo-3-methyl-, methyl ester
- Methyl 2-bromo-3-methylbut-2-enoate
- 2-BroMo-3-Methyl-2-butenoic Acid Methyl Ester
- Methyl 2-BroMo-3,3-diMethylacrylate
- 2-BroMo-3-Methylbutenoic Acid Methyl Ester
